The general aspects of excavations simulation are discussed, taking into account the non-linear behavior of soil, the possibility of supporting structures and effects due temperature variations. An incremental analysis is made, which is able to simulate any construction sequence. The isoparametric quadratic element used confers considerable flexibility to the program. Some comparisons with actual cases are made.","abstract_html":"Elaboration of a computer program applying the Finite Element Method for the analysis of excavations in soils, struted or not.
